i already use freewebs but what makes this one better and different from them?
 
micron
post Apr 26 2008, 01:14 AM
Post #72


cb's #1 fan! =)
******

Group: Advisor
Posts: 2,342
Joined: Nov 2003
Member No: 1



^ well for starters you get MUCH more space + bandwidth. freewebs offer 40mb space + 500mb/month bandwidth. then theres cpanel... a comprehensive control panel where you can set up email accounts, subdomains (if you have a domain), mysql dbs, and much much more. ofcourse, at the end of the day, its really up to you. =)
